Abstract

According to the video monitoring new requirements, this paper studies a set of intelligent video surveillance and retrieval system based on FPGA. The system can realize the video at the same time, face detection, intelligent background removal, and the video structural description. The hardware of the system can accelerate the intelligent video systems, that could achieve rapid analysis, process monitoring video, and quickly processing results are obtained.
